I offer you a fairly well-known task. But here I have not seen her yet. A. Einstein invented it in the last century and believed that 98% of the inhabitants of the Earth are not able to solve it in the mind.
And so, here's the task text itself:
1. There are 5 houses each in a different color.
2. In each house there lives one person of a different nationality.
3. Each resident drinks only one specific drink, smokes a certain brand of cigarettes and holds a certain animal.
4. None of the 5 people drinks the same as other drinks, does not smoke the same cigarettes and does not keep the same animal.
It is known that:
Englishman lives in a red house
Swede keeps dog
Dane drinking tea
The green house is to the left of the white one (consider that these houses stand side by side - otherwise the problem will produce two solutions).
Green house dweller drinks coffee
The man who smokes Pall Mall keeps a bird
The average house dweller drinks milk
The yellow house dweller smokes Dunhill
Norwegian lives in the first house
Smoker Marlboro lives about the one who holds the cat
The man who keeps the horse lives near the one who smokes Dunhill
Winfield cigarette smoker drinking beer
Norwegian lives near the blue house
German smokes Rothmans
Smoker Marlboro lives next door to a man who drinks water
Question:
